Best SEO Tools for Ranking the Website

Published on: 02 November 2017 Last Updated on: 02 December 2021
Best SEO Tools In 2022

In my previous post, I shared,  4 WordPress Plugins to Make Your Blog More Powerful. Today I’m going to share the best SEO tools for rank the website on the search engine to increase the website traffic. There are plenty of paid and free SEO Tools for ranking the keywords, below is the list of best SEO tools for ranking the website or keywords.   

Best SEO Tools Of 2021-2022   

There are several best SEO Tools you can have to make your journey easier in this domain. You have to follow several aspects while you want to improve your business in 2021-2022.

Most Popular Plugin WordPress SEO by Yoast

I always recommend to everyone to use WordPress SEO Plugin by Yoast for the better result, it is my favorite too and I love to use it on my every website. It has been installed more than one millions times and is favorite of almost every WordPress user. This plugin makes things really easy for the user which are really effective for ranking the keywords. You can set your Title, description, keywords density, URL structure with ease.

It helps you to main the good SEO Score by some signal like if you are seeing red signals then you need to improve your SEO score and if you get the Green signal or dot then you did well.

All in One SEO

All in one SEO pack is also favorite one for many of WordPress users, it is a bit similar the Yoast and provide all feature which is necessary to optimize or rank the website and to make website SEO friendly. You don’t need to be expert or hire someone to do the task for you, you can familiar with this plugin in few Hours and can optimize your website easily.

You can easily set up the Meta tags, Titles, description etc. according to the requirements of Google and other search engines.


SEOPressor is another tool to optimize the website to increase the organic traffic from the search engines. Due to the number of features, this plugin is getting popular among the WordPress users. It will keep suggesting you during the SEO process for Good SEO score, like setting the title, description, keyword density etc. to optimize the website.

You can find the built-in keywords research tool in SEOPressor for choosing the long tail keywords according to your content and website so you can rank the keyword easily in search engines.

There is a testing system in SEOpressor for checking the SEO Score of post and articles, which help to make the content SEO Optimize. This plugin is also good to optimize the post pages.

W3 Total Cache

Google consider lots of factors for ranking the website or keyword. One most important factor which Google consider to rank the keywords is website speed. if your speed is slow then you must install the W3 Total Cache to improve the website speed, slow speed can waste your traffic and affect your website ranking. W3 Total Cache has more than 900,000 active installs and good rating and reviews by the users.

Broken Link Checker

Broken links which are disturbing and annoying the users and going wrong way can waste your traffic. Broken links also affect your website ranking and can be a great hurdle in optimizing the website. you don’t need to do much just install the broken link checker and let plugin to scan your post, pages, images etc. which can you edit as normal content.

According to SmallSeoTools, there are  a lots of free SEO tools that can compete with paid tools. Great SEO Management is crucial for your website rankings. Linkio is a link building management platform that helps SEO teams use data to plan their strategy and provides workflow management for monthly activities.


Maya is IT Girl and Full-time writer and Digital marketing specialist since 4 years, she always likes to write on tech topic. She spent most of her career as Guest Blogger and Digital marking expert.


Content Rally wrapped around an online publication where you can publish your own intellectuals. It is a publishing platform designed to make great stories by content creators. This is your era, your place to be online. So come forward share your views, thoughts and ideas via Content Rally.

View all posts

Leave a Reply

Your email address will not be published. Required fields are marked *


Mastering SEO: Tips And Techniques For Improved Search Rankings

In the highly competitive digital landscape, search engine optimization (SEO) has become essential for businesses looking to improve their online visibility and attract organic traffic. SEO techniques focus on optimizing websites and content to rank higher in search engine results pages (SERPs) and reach the target audience effectively. Mastering SEO requires a combination of technical expertise, content optimization, and staying up-to-date with search engine algorithms. Here are some tips and techniques to help you improve your search rankings and dominate the SEO game. Keyword Research Conduct thorough keyword research to identify the terms and phrases your target audience is searching for. Use keyword research tools to find relevant and high-volume keywords with moderate competition. Incorporate these keywords naturally into your website content, including titles, headings, meta descriptions, and body text. Aim for a balance between relevancy and user intent to attract qualified traffic. Do you know? You can build your SEO even with email marketing! It is always a great marketing strategy that doesn’t require much investment, yet you get greater results. Finding the right email addresses and connecting to your target audience is the key. How do you find the correct email address, you ask? Simple - This AI-powered tool helps you how to lookup an email address with ease. You can use its extension even on platforms like LinkedIn, Gmail, and Salesforce too! Quality Content Creation Creating high-quality and valuable content is paramount for SEO success. Develop content that addresses the needs and interests of your target audience. Use a mix of formats such as blog posts, videos, infographics, and guides to engage users. Focus on creating long-form content that thoroughly covers the topic, providing comprehensive information and insights. Ensure your content is well-structured, easy to read, and optimized for relevant keywords. Ideally, the audience must find your content comprehensive because comprehensive pages help search engines bring authority to the same topic. We all know how evergreen content has a prolonged value which makes it relevant for a long time.  On-Page Optimization Optimize your website's on-page elements to improve search rankings. Pay attention to title tags, meta descriptions, headings (H1, H2, etc.), and URL structures. Incorporate target keywords naturally in these elements while maintaining clarity and relevance. Optimize image alt tags and file names, as search engines also consider visual content. Improve website loading speed by compressing images, magnifying code, and leveraging browser caching. On-page SEO is the measures that one can take directly within the site for improving its place in the search rankings. Examples of on-page site optimization are content optimization or including the title tags and meta description. Technical SEO Technical aspects of SEO play a crucial role in search rankings. Ensure your website has proper crawl ability and index ability. Submit an XML sitemap to search engines to help them understand your website's structure. Optimize your website for mobile devices, as mobile-friendliness is a significant ranking factor. Ensure your website has a secure HTTPS protocol implemented, as it provides a secure browsing experience and is favored by search engines. Technical SEO is largely responsible for a website’s performance on search engines like Google. A Website’s page speed and mobile responsiveness are confirmed banking factors by Google.  Regular Monitoring And Analysis Continuously monitor your website's performance using analytics tools like Google Analytics. Track important metrics such as organic traffic, search rankings, bounce rates, and conversions. Analyze the data to identify trends, strengths, and areas for improvement. Use this information to refine your SEO strategies and adapt to changing algorithms. Backlink Building Building high-quality backlinks from reputable and relevant websites is crucial for SEO success. Focus on earning backlinks naturally through compelling content, guest blogging, influencer partnerships, and outreach efforts. Quality over quantity is key when it comes to backlinks. Avoid questionable link-building practices that may lead to penalties from search engines. Backlinks are inbound links that are links generated from a particular website to another with the help of an anchor text. Google and other search engines regard backlinks as “votes” for a desired page, thereby denoting the quality and relevance of the web page.  User Experience Optimization User experience (UX) is a critical factor in search rankings. Make sure your website is intuitive, easy to navigate, and visually appealing. Optimize for mobile devices, as the majority of searches now occur on mobile. Improve page load times, as slow-loading pages can negatively impact user experience and search rankings. Focus on reducing bounce rates and increasing engagement metrics, such as time spent on site and pages per session. In order to boost retention, it is significant to optimize the user experience of a website page. When you keep improving user satisfaction, there will be fewer risks of users navigating to other websites. Local SEO If you have a local business, optimizing for local search is crucial. Ensure your website includes location-specific keywords, and register your business on Google My Business and other relevant directories. Encourage positive online reviews from satisfied customers, as they can enhance your local search visibility. In simple terms, Local SEO is a strategy that makes your business more visible in Google’s local search results.  Stay Up-To-Date With Algorithm Changes Search engine algorithms evolve regularly, and staying informed is crucial. Follow industry experts, blogs, and official search engine announcements to keep up with the latest trends and algorithm updates. Adapt your SEO strategies accordingly to maintain or improve your search rankings. Google’s Algorithm keeps changing consistently. Thus, you need to be on par with those to make your website page a big hit.  Patience and Persistence: SEO is a long-term game. It takes time to see significant results, and search rankings can fluctuate. Be patient, persistent, and consistent with your efforts. Continuously improve your website, create valuable content, and adapt to changes in the SEO landscape. Over time, your efforts will pay off with improved search rankings and increased organic traffic. In conclusion mastering SEO requires a comprehensive approach that encompasses technical optimization, quality content creation, and a focus on user experience. Stay informed, adapt to changes, and consistently refine your SEO strategies to stay ahead in the competitive digital landscape Read Also: 3 Major SEO Predictions for 2020 How to Monitor the SEO Health of Your Website Improve Your Domain Using These SEO tips 5 Things You Are Not Checking In SEO But You Should!

PPC Agency

8 Tips For Hiring The Right PPC Agency

If you’re looking for a way to drive more leads and sales for your business, you may be considering hiring a PPC agency in Toronto. Pay-per-click (PPC) campaigns can be an effective tool for driving targeted traffic to your website and generating conversions. However, it’s important to choose the right PPC agency to ensure you get the best results from your campaigns. In this blog post, we’ll discuss tips for hiring the right PPC agency. Here Are Eight Prime Ideas For Hiring The Right PPC Agency Let us dive in: 1. Define Your Objectives Before you start looking for a PPC agency to hire, it’s important to take the time to define your objectives. What are your goals? Do you want to increase website traffic, drive conversions or boost brand awareness? Or do you have multiple goals that need to be achieved? Knowing exactly what you want from the agency will help you find the best fit for your needs. Additionally, having an understanding of your own internal resources and capabilities can help you determine what kind of agency you need to achieve your goals. Once you know what your objectives are and what type of help you need, you can begin the process of researching potential agencies. 2. Do Your Research The other step should always be to do your research. Start by searching online and looking at reviews of different agencies. You should also check out the websites and social media profiles of the agencies you’re considering. This will give you an idea of their expertise, and the types of services they offer. It’s also important to read up on industry news and trends to make sure that the agency you’re considering is up-to-date with the latest changes in PPC. Doing your research can also help you find a few agencies you’d like to contact. Make sure to take your time and evaluate the options you have. 3. Consider the Size When it comes to hiring a PPC agency, one of the most important factors to consider is the size of the agency. A larger agency may have more resources, experience, and expertise to draw from when managing your campaigns. However, a smaller agency may provide a more personalized approach that you may prefer. It’s important to assess the size of the agency and consider if they have enough resources and capabilities to provide you with the results you’re looking for. Think about the size of your budget and the scope of your campaigns to determine what size of an agency will best fit your needs. 4. Check Their Case Studies It's important to take the time to review their case studies. Case studies are an important way to gain insight into the strategies that a PPC agency uses to achieve results for its clients. Ask the agency for links to their case studies and review them. Ensure they have experience with clients similar to your business in terms of size and industry. This will help you get an idea of the results the agency can deliver for you. Additionally, don’t be afraid to ask for further details about the case studies. This will help you better understand the campaigns and how successful they were. It can also help you decide if the PPC agency protects your data and is right for you. 5. Make Sure They're Certified Another important criterion is to make sure that they're certified. This is especially true if you're looking for a PPC agency in Toronto. Many agencies claim to be experts in the field but may not have the necessary qualifications or certifications to back up their claims. Look for certifications from major search engines such as Google and Bing, as well as professional organizations. Ask the agency directly what certifications they hold and check to see if they are legitimate. A certified PPC agency will be able to provide you with the best service and ensure that your campaigns are run in a compliant manner. 6. Find out About Their Clients When researching potential PPC agencies, one of the most important questions you can ask is who their clients are. Knowing who the agency currently works with will give you a good indication of their experience and success in the field. You should also look for clients that are in the same industry as you. It will give you a better understanding of how well they’ll be able to service your own needs. When looking at the client list of a potential PPC agency, you should also consider their level of involvement with each client. Ask them how long they’ve been working with the client and what types of services they provide. Also, make sure to look out for any awards or industry recognition they may have won while working with that client. This will give you a better idea of their capabilities and how well they’ve been able to service their other customers. 7. Check Their References When you’re looking for a PPC agency in Toronto, it’s important to make sure you check out their references. A reputable PPC agency will be able to provide a list of clients who have had positive experiences with their services. Ask the agency for a few contacts you can talk to and get feedback from. Make sure to ask if the agency was able to meet its client's expectations and goals. You should also inquire about the customer service they received and the quality of results they achieved. Gathering feedback from former and current clients is a great way to get an inside look into the work of the agency and its capabilities. 8. Get a Proposal Getting a proposal from potential PPC agencies is an important step in the hiring process. A well-crafted proposal can give you a better understanding of the agency’s capabilities and how they plan to help you achieve your goals. When requesting a proposal, provide the agency with a clear list of your objectives and expectations, as well as any relevant data or information about your business and current campaigns. This will help them create a more detailed and accurate proposal for you. Conclusion When it comes to hiring a PPC agency in Toronto, there are many factors to consider. By following these tips, you can ensure that you are making the right decision for your business when hiring a PPC agency. Remember to carefully review the proposal before making a decision. Good luck! Read Also: Why Would The Data For A Search Network Campaign Show Conversions But No View-through Conversions? To Increase The Speed At Which Google Analytics Compiles Reports – What Action Could Be Taken? Quality Of E-Commerce Data Entry Services- Whether You Should Invest In Them?

organic traffic vs paid

Organic Traffic vs. Paid: Where Should You Focus Your Budget?

Getting potential and paying customers, who will bring your business success and ranking, demands many efforts. You will need to have a certain plan to understand your business goals for attracting visitors and making them your “happy clients”. People will hardly find your business if you do not “help” them. Here a question arises: How? Surely with the help of eCommerce marketing tactics. You will need to invest some money in order to have success in this competitive online marketplace. You can have your success either with organic traffic, or eCommerce PPC management. However, first, it is important to find out which of these two approaches will drive more traffic to your website and convert them into paying clients.                                       SEO and PPC are two completely different approaches, although they share the same goal: bringing more traffic and high ranking. One of the vital differences that we can mention is that you invest your time for SEO, while for PPC you invest money. However, if you hire an SEO agency, in order to implement the best tactics for your success, here not directly, but you as well pay money. Both SEO and PPC are effective. However, let us find out the best option for you to focus your budget. 1. Benefits of Organic Traffic Organic traffic comes from an organic search. Its role in your business is really important. It brings you real visitors providing you with conversion rates. Its benefits are a lot. However, the main ones include: Better User Experience; Higher Conversion Rates; Higher Brand Credibility; A long Term Marketing Strategy; A Cost-Effective and Sustainable Approach. Targeted keywords help potential clients to meet your business very quickly, as mostly when they want something, first of all, they try to find it in search engines. Many people give their preferences to the organic search results rather than advertisements. It means that through SEO you can increase your traffic, without any additional expenses for each click. Besides, organic SEO is long-lasting, regardless of the fact that it takes longer than PPC. 2. Benefits of Paid Traffic Pay per Click (PPC) demands a certain amount of money for each click. In case of SEO you “earn” visits to your website, while in case of PPC you “buy” them. It allows you to reach a targeted audience. However, you need to pay a fee when someone clicks your ad. Among the main benefits, you should remember that PPC: Increases brand recognition; Helps to get fast results; Offers fast entry; Works well with different marketing channels; Gives the opportunity to choose your audience (based on location, place, gadget, etc.). One important fact about PPC is that it is independent of Google Algorithmic changes. In comparison to SEO, its results are faster. You can see them almost immediately. 3. Combining SEO and PPC Both SEO and PPC are great channels and each of them includes unique approaches for your business growth. While deciding which one is better for your business, you can detect one more option as well: combining them together to gain more customers and boost revenue. It will really provide you with greater and more effective results rather than using them separately. However, you need to review your tactics when using them together. You can easily replace the word “VS” with the word “AND”. Each of these methods has its important impacts on your business. You can mix their tactics and best practices taking advantage of both. This is a great step for not only SEO marketing but for PPC as well. Read Also: 5 Inexpensive Tips On How To Scale Your SEO Business 5 Things You Are Not Checking In SEO But You Should!